banner-bookname banner1 banner2 banner3 banner4

目錄

1        計算力的追求

1.1     概述

1.2 計算力就是生產力

1.3 計算力的兩極化發展

1.4 雲端運算是IT的“第三產業”

1.5 小結

習題

2        走近雲端運算

2.1 初識雲端運算

2.2 走近雲端運算

2.2.1 相關技術發展歷程

2.3 雲端運算:網格和SaaS的融合

2.3.1 HPC和網格運算

2.3.2 SaaSXaaS

2.4 雲端運算:ICT的“通天塔”

2.5 小結

習題

3        虛擬化與雲端運算

3.1 虛擬化技術與分類探討

3.2 單機虛擬化

3.2.1 Hypervisor技術

3.2.2 Hypervisor產品

3.2.3 VMWareXen

3.2.4 其他虛擬化技術

3.3 多機虛擬化:雲端運算的根基

3.4 小結

習題

4        HPC系統及其發展

4.1 分散式計算與平行計算

4.2 超級電腦的發展及其應用

4.2.1 “牛”計算改變格局

4.2.2 超級計算與Grand Challenges

4.2.3 HPC電腦群與BOINC

4.3 HPC系統的系統架構

4.3.1 Flynn-Johnson分類法

4.3.2 共用記憶體與SMP

4.3.3 分散式記憶體與MPP

4.3.4 HPS高性能路由器

4.4 超級計算TOP 500

4.4.1 Graph500GPU

4.5 小結

習題

5        HPC軟體與中間層

5.1 平行和分散式演算法

5.1.1 AmdahlGustafson定律

5.2 並行處理程式設計模式

5.2.1 ImplicitExplicit程式模式

5.3 HPC中間層軟體與多機虛擬化

5.3.1 PVMMPIMapReduce

5.4 作業排程與管理

5.4.1 CondorHadoop

5.4.2 中斷點、遷移和VMotion

5.5 機群和群集

5.5.1 BeowulfLVSMOSIX

5.6 網格運算與網格中間層

5.6.1 Globus Toolkit

5.7 小結

習題

6        商用分散式運算與雲端運算

6.1 EDOC技術與企業級中間層

6.1.1 CORBA.NETJava EE

6.2 公用(Utility)計算

6.3 普及計算與行動計算

6.4 P2P網格運算與JXTA

6.5 綠色(Green)計算與雲端運算

6.5.1 Google資料中心技術

6.6 平行檔案系統

6.6.1 GPFSLustreHDFS

6.7 小結

習題

7        SaaSSOA與雲端服務

7.1 SaaS:軟體即服務

7.1.1 Salesforce:軟體終結者

7.1.2 Multi-Tenancy技術與模式

7.2 SaaS與套裝軟體

7.2.1 Google大戰微軟

7.2.2 國內外SaaS發展現況

7.2.3 SaaSSPI

7.3 SOASaaS和雲端運算的基礎

7.3.1 SOAEAI

7.3.2 SOASaaS

7.3.3 SOA與雲端運算

7.4 SaaS 3.0:雲端服務

7.4.1 行動雲端服務

7.4.2 XaaS與物聯網

7.5 小結

習題

8        雲端運算系統架構

8.1 NIST的雲端運算定義

8.2 雲端運算系統架構

8.2.1 三層SPI架構

8.2.2 四種部署方式

8.2.3 五大關鍵功能

8.2.4 六大基本特性

8.3 統一Fabric和網路雲端

8.4 雲端安全與安全作為雲端服務

8.5 雲端儲存技術與雲端儲存服務

8.6 行動雲端運算(MCC

8.7 小結

習題

9        雲端運算典型技術與系統

9.1 雲端中間層和雲端系統

9.1.1 IaaS中間層

9.1.2 PaaS中間層

9.1.3 雲端系統

9.2 典型IaaS技術和系統

9.2.1 Amazon Web ServicesAWS

9.2.2 Eucalyptus

9.2.3 開源IaaSOpenStack

9.3 典型PaaS技術和系統

9.3.1 APEXForce.com

9.3.2 App EngineAppScale

9.3.3 Apache Hadoop和開源PaaS

9.4 雲端運算系統全景圖

9.5 小結

習題

10    雲端運算和標準化

10.1 通天塔與標準化

10.2 SPI標準化

10.2.1 可行性探討

10.2.2 現有成果介紹

10.2.3 雲端運算宣言

10.3 網格和SOA的融合

10.3.1 作業描述語言標準化案例

10.3.2  網格內部標準化

10.4 雲端安全與雲端儲存標準化

10.5 小結

習題

11    雲端運算業務模式探討

11.1 The Big Switch

11.1.1 雲端運算市場規模

11.2 SPI業務模式推動商業模式

11.2.1 SaaSPaaS:收割長尾

11.2.2 IaaS:碳足跡和硬體終結者.

11.2.3 B&H長尾與雲端商業模式

11.3 雲端運算現況和趨勢

11.3.1 產業慣性定律的反作用

11.3.2 技術和業務十大趨勢

11.3.3 15年週期與Gartner週期

11.4 小結

習題

12    進入雲端的大門

12.1 使用最著名的基礎建設即服務的Amazon網路服務

12.1.1 Amazon Elastic Computing (Amazon EC2)上啟動伺服器

12.1.2 開始提供Web服務

12.1.3 指定實體IP位置

12.1.4 Amazon網路服務小結

12.2 平台即服務的代表Google App Engine (GAE) for Java

12.2.1 GAE的特性與其限制

12.2.2 安裝GAE開發環境與新增專案

12.2.3 註冊GAE服務並上傳網頁

12.2.4 上傳網頁並開始提供Web服務

12.2.5 執行JSP程式

12.3 一定要會用的SaaS雲端服務:Dropbox雲端儲存

12.3.1 註冊Dropbox與檔案的同步化

12.3.2 如何救回刪除的檔案與版本控制

12.3.3 與他人共享資料夾

12.4 小結

習題

總結

 

參考文獻

 

附錄

A.1 中國雲端運算標準化情況

A.2 中國雲端運算業務模式的現況和對策

A.2.1 雲端?政府的作為

A.2.2 企業如何把握機遇和核心技術

A.3 DIY實務:如何自建一台超級電腦

A.3.1  “窮人”超級電腦搭建步驟

A.3.2  “富人”超級電腦搭建步驟